Ron:
I saw a demonstration of this technique on a V6 CC mini-van on 'Shadetree
Mechanic'. It looked pretty straight forward. Just needed to disable the
electric fuel pump and connect the fluid can into the fuel rail (which had
a fitting). Van ran on the stuff for about 5 min. and presto, injectors
were cleaned.
They indicated that the product was available at the local parts store, but
it wasn't cheap.
